Soon sympathy for Pip develops as he seems helpless. He has gone to visit his parents, maybe in the hope to feel close to them, yet he is left alone and feels isolated. Pips isolation and vulnerability is revealed when he describes himself as "bundle of shivers". These three words produce powerful emotions, for me, because I would associate them with something as defenceless as a puppy or a kitten...
